Community & charity of the year partnerships

  • TXO will select up to 5 community and/or charitable partnerships per year 
  • TXO’s community & charitable activity should be focused on these organisations 
  • We will develop these relationships where possible through in-kind support and a donation, raising awareness of our support of these organisations both internally and externally
  • Other community & charitable giving will continue on a local basis, as happens now 

Criteria for community & charity of the year partnerships

  • They must be a registered charity or a community club/organisation 
  • Their purpose should align with TXO’s values (i.e. focused, trusted and dynamic)
  • They should enhance our reputation as a responsible company
  • They should not support any extremist, political or religious causes 
  • Consideration should be given to the community & charitable causes that are supported by our employees or those that our employees indicate they are particularly passionate about 

Focus areas

Our priority will be to support community and charitable partners that make a positive difference in the following 6 focus areas: 

  1. Telco & education – improving accessibility and developing people to be the best they can be 
  2. Community – encouraging our people to get involved in their local communities and at the same time developing their skills
  3. Health – improving people’s health and wellbeing, raising awareness and promoting understanding 
  4. Sustainability & circular economy – we’re a company that acts in an environmentally conscious way in everything we do
  5. Equality – if we want to build a better society, it is essential we take action 
  6. International – we are an international company with a global impact 

Employee fundraising

  • If employees are doing a personal challenge or event and fundraising, they will be encouraged to support one of TXO’s community and charity of the year partnerships (as detailed above) 
  • Approval may only be given once it has been verified that the organisation in question meets our criteria 

Process for application

To be fair to all we have a simple 3 step process. 

  1. We have an easy-to-use application form, open to TXO Group employees only 
  2. Applications will be reviewed by our community & charity policy committee (CCPC) 
  3. Where successful, the TXO Group employee will be appointed as our representative for liaising with the community & charity of the year partner 

Governance

We operate under a proper and effective governance structure to protect our contribution to our purpose, brand and to our relationships with regulators and other lawmakers, as well as our partners. We have set up a working group, called the community & charity policy committee (CCPC), to review this policy and agree upon the selection of charities. To maintain impartiality, members of the CCPC are not eligible to apply for support.
